Sands China FY26 H1 profit falls 3.6% to US$398 million; total net revenues rise 11.1% to US$3.88 billion
LVS•Key results and dividend
- Sands China posted profit attributable to equity holders of US$398 million, down 3.6%, as total net revenues rose 11.1% to US$3.88 billion.
- Operating profit slipped to US$558 million from stronger costs, with gaming tax at US$1.56 billion and employee benefit expenses at US$717 million.
- Adjusted property EBITDA fell 3.4% to US$1.07 billion, with gains at The Londoner Macao offset by declines at The Venetian Macao.
- Net casino revenues climbed 12% to US$2.93 billion, while room revenue increased 5.9% to US$430 million and mall revenue rose 6.8% to US$266 million.
- The board declared an interim dividend of HK$0.5 per share, totaling HK$4.05 billion, payable Oct. 9 to holders on record .
